Crunchy Fruits and Veggies



When snacking on crispy fruits and vegetables, you can properly boost the health of your teeth and periodontals. These healthy treats serve as all-natural toothbrushes, aiding to remove plaque and food particles from your teeth.

The act of eating on crispy fruits and vegetables also promotes saliva manufacturing, which aids to counteract acid and prevent dental caries. In addition, the fibrous texture of these foods can help to enhance your gums and promote better general oral health and wellness.

Some examples of crispy vegetables and fruits that are good for your teeth include apples, carrots, celery, and cucumbers.

Lean Meats and Fish



Wanting to boost your oral health and wellness? Increase your oral hygiene by incorporating lean meats and fish into your diet.

Lean meats, such as chicken and turkey, are superb resources of healthy protein that can aid strengthen your gums and teeth. Healthy protein is essential for the development and repair service of tissues in the body, consisting of the periodontals.

Fish, such as salmon and tuna, are rich in omega-3 fats, which have anti-inflammatory buildings that can reduce gum tissue inflammation and advertise periodontal health. Additionally, fish is a great resource of vitamin D, which is necessary for the absorption of calcium, a mineral that's vital for solid teeth and bones.

Water



Drinking water is an essential part of keeping healthy and balanced teeth and gum tissues. Water assists to wash away food bits and microorganisms that can result in tooth decay and gum tissue disease. It's suggested to consume alcohol water after dishes and snacks to assist rinse your mouth and reduce the danger of dental caries.

Water also helps in the manufacturing of saliva, which is very important for maintaining your mouth wet and counteracting acids that can wear down tooth enamel.

In addition, remaining moistened with water can help avoid completely dry mouth, a problem that can add to foul-smelling breath and dental cavity.
